How much do insurance adjuster assistant j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for insurance adjuster assistant in Atlanta, GA is $71,816.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$46,200.00 and $96,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an insurance adjuster assistant, and why are they important?

To excel as an Insurance Adjuster Assistant, you need strong organizational abilities,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of insurance principles, often supported by a high school diploma or relevant coursework. Familiarity with claims management software, document processing tools, and office systems is typically required. Excellent communication, multitasking, and problem-solving skills help you coordinate with clients and support adjusters efficiently. These abilities are crucial for ensuring accurate claims processing and smooth workflow in a fast-paced insurance environment.

How does an insurance adjuster assistant typically collaborate with adjusters and other team members during the claims process?

As an Insurance Adjuster Assistant, you'll work closely with adjusters by gathering and organizing claim documentation, communicating with claimants, and scheduling inspections or follow-ups. You may also coordinate with other departments, such as legal or underwriting, to obtain necessary information. Effective collaboration and clear communication are vital, as you'll help ensure claims are processed efficiently and accurately, often acting as a key point of contact between adjusters and clients.

What is an insurance adjuster assistant?

Insurance Adjuster Assistants support insurance adjusters in the process of evaluating and settling insurance claims. Their duties often include gathering documentation, communicating with clients, organizing claim files, and assisting with the administrative aspects of the claims process. By performing these tasks, they help adjusters work more efficiently and ensure claims are processed accurately and promptly. They play a critical role in the insurance industry by helping maintain smooth operations and high customer satisfaction.

Job description

Summary

We are seeking a Case Manager to join our team. As a Case Manager you must be highly organized and able to work on a varied caseload. The Case Manager will assist the attorney in developing settlements, preparing documents and correspondence as needed. The ideal candidate is customer focused and empathetic.

Responsibilities

  • Daily interaction with existing and potential clients, via telephone and in person.
  • Order medical records from providers and communicate with clients and providers during the course of treatment.
  • Obtain documents necessary to support injury and/or liability positions
  • Interact with insurance carriers and healthcare providers to secure records and account balances
  • Work directly with multiple coworkers involved in the management and support of case files
  • Maintain organized case files.
  • Prepare comprehensive demands and assemble support for submission to carriers under the direct supervision of an attorney
  • Interact with attorneys and present case synopsis when required
  • Manage case files from intake to closing under the direction of an attorney
  • Performs other related duties as assigned to meet the needs of the business

Qualification

  • Bachelor's degree (preferred)
  • Prior experience as a Personal Injury Case Manager preferred.
  • At least 2 years of working in a legal position or insurance adjuster experience preferred.
  • Ability to be a team player and follow procedures.
  • Proactive interaction with clients, insurance companies and medical providers.
  • Must possess the ability to multi-task, prioritize, and manage workload with a positive attitude and minimal supervision.
  • Highly organized with the ability to juggle multiple deadlines in a fast-paced environment
  • Strong writing and communication skills along with attention to detail
  • Extensive computer and database expertise, Microsoft Word, Excel, Outlook, and type no less than 35 wpm.
